CP/IP,SPDY,WebSocket 三者之間的關係

標籤:按照OSI網路分層模型,IP是網路層協議,TCP是傳輸層協議,而HTTP是應用程式層的協議。在這三者之間,SPDY和WebSocket都是與HTTP相關的協議,而TCP是HTTP底層的協議。一、HTTP的不足HTTP協議經過多年的使用,發現了一些不足,主要是效能方面的,包括:HTTP的串連問題,HTTP用戶端和伺服器之間的互動是採用請求/接聽模式,在用戶端請求時,會建立一個HTTP串連,然後發送請求訊息,服務端給出應答訊息,然後串連就關閉了。(後來的HTTP1.1支援持久串連)因為TCP串

網站的SEO以及它和站長工具的之間秘密

標籤:部落格遷移沒有注意 URL 地址的變化,導致百度和 google 這兩隻爬蟲引擎短時間內找不到路。近段時間研究了下國內最大搜尋引擎百度和國際最大搜尋引擎google的站長工具,說下感受。百度的站長工具地址:http://zhanzhang.baidu.com/dashboard/indexgoogle 的站長工具地址: https://www.google.com/webmasters/tools/home最近牆的比較厲害,google 不一定能訪問進去(我平時用的

【Node.js基礎篇】(十)使用net模組和Readline模組實現Socket通訊,node.jsreadline

【Node.js基礎篇】(十)使用net模組和Readline模組實現Socket通訊,node.jsreadline Node.js的socket通訊和C++、Java的非常相像,學過這兩種語言的socket通訊的同學可以很快就掌握好Node.js的socket通訊。下面我們以實現一個Echo伺服器的服務端和用戶端為目的,學習一下Node.js的socket通訊。

PHP幸運大轉盤源碼,支援ThinkPHP,大轉盤thinkphp

PHP幸運大轉盤源碼,支援ThinkPHP,大轉盤thinkphpHTML代碼代碼是基於thinkphp的,如果你的不是,修改裡面的url路徑就行了charset="utf-8">name="keywords"content="幸運大轉盤,cnsecer.com"/>name="description"content="幸運大轉盤"/>幸運大轉盤type="text/c

IIS6/7/8 WEB伺服器不能訪問grf報表範本檔案的問題,iis6grf

IIS6/7/8 WEB伺服器不能訪問grf報表範本檔案的問題,iis6grf    通過 IE不能訪問到 .grf 報表檔案,這是因為 IIS6/7/8對訪問的副檔名做了限制,除了已經定義的副檔名之外,其他的副檔名都不能訪問,這跟 IIS5 不一樣,IIS5 對所有的副檔名都不做限制。解決辦法:開啟“Internet資訊服務”管理介面,增加“.grf”副檔名定義 MIME類型,這樣就能夠直接下載.grf檔案。具體操作步驟:1. 開啟 IIS Microsoft 管理主控台(

Highcharts資料表示(3),highcharts資料表示

Highcharts資料表示(3),highcharts資料表示Highcharts資料表示(3)採用對象數組的形式,可以明確節點上每個項目的值。但是當節點較多時,會造成大量的冗餘代碼。如果不寫配置項名稱,對象數組就可以簡化二維數組。形式如下:data:[[Number|String , Number , Color , Number|String|Object],[Number|String , Number , Color ,

《ASP.NET》資料的綁定—Repeater,

《ASP.NET》資料的綁定—Repeater,     前面學習了HTML靜態網頁編程,瞭解了其中的一些文法,但是自己感覺對Web編程掌握的還不夠過癮,於是跟著計劃,開始了ASP.NET之旅。在寫這篇ASP.NET部落格之前之前,我想先將先比較一下ASP.NET與HTML的區別與聯絡。     一、聯絡與區別:HTML是在用戶端編程,通常產生的是靜態網頁;ASP.NET是在伺服器端編程,通常能產生動態網頁。ASP.

美團前端面試小結,美團面試小結

美團前端面試小結,美團面試小結 美團是我自學前端以來第一次去現場的面試,在網上搜了一下以往的面經,普遍反映說美團面試超級高效,都是技術面,這次去真的是體驗到了。一共面了三輪,每輪都差不多一個小時,都要寫代碼。 一面主要是考察對CSS、JavaScript基本知識的掌握,資料結構演算法也會問。總之就是對考察基本功啦。 二面就沒那麼細了,稍微宏觀一點,有一種考察你對前端有沒有sense的感覺,比如在怎麼實現一個模組,有哪些方法、注意事項啥的,當然也會寫代碼。

javascript函數的使用,javascript函數

javascript函數的使用,javascript函數一:函數的基本用法<script type="text/javascript">function test1(num1,num2){return num1+num2;}//普通調用window.alert(test1(2,3));//指標調用var my=test1;window.alert(my);var res=my(3,4);alert(res);</script>二:函數調用機制&

Objective-C 【NSString 的其他常見用法】,objectivecnsstring

Objective-C 【NSString 的其他常見用法】,objectivecnsstring———————————————————————————————————————————NSString 的其他常見用法//  NSString 長度、擷取字串中的每個字元、類型轉換、去除前後空格等#import <Foundation/Foundation.h>void test1(){    //   

FlowLayoutPanel控制項,flowlayoutpanel

FlowLayoutPanel控制項,flowlayoutpanel最近用到了FlowLayoutPanel控制項。感覺功能很強大~整理記錄如下:msdn的描述是這樣的:FlowLayoutPanel控制項沿著水平或垂直流方向排列其內容。其內容可以從一行換到下一行。或者,還可以對它的內容進行剪裁,而不是進行換行。可以通過設定FlowDirection 屬性的值來指定流向。在從右向左(RTL)的布局中,FlowLayoutPanel

三大UI架構Dijit、ExtJS、jQuery UI全方位對比

三大UI架構Dijit、ExtJS、jQuery UI全方位對比 Dijit、ExtJS、jQuery UI 簡介  Dojo 是開源 ja vasc ript 庫中起步較早的先行者之一。由 Alex Russell, David Schontzler, Dylan Schiemann 等人於 2004 年創立。Dojo 具有類似 Java 的包機制 (packaging system), 將 JS 代碼根據功能進行了模組化。主要包含 Dojo、Dijit 以及 Dojox

基於python 的Apriori演算法,pythonApriori演算法

基於python 的Apriori演算法,pythonApriori演算法  Apriori algorithm是關聯規則裡一項基本演算法。是由Rakesh Agrawal和Ramakrishnan Srikant兩位博士在1994年提出的關聯規則挖掘演算法。關聯規則的目的就是在一個資料集中找出項與項之間的關係,也被稱為購物藍分析 (Market Basket analysis),因為“購物藍分析”很貼切的表達了適用該演算法情景中的一個子集。

《機器學習實戰》學習筆記:繪製樹形圖&amp;使用決策樹預測隱形眼鏡類型,

《機器學習實戰》學習筆記:繪製樹形圖&使用決策樹預測隱形眼鏡類型,

Node.js開發入門—使用對話方塊ngDialog,node.jsngdialog

Node.js開發入門—使用對話方塊ngDialog,node.jsngdialog

【Cactus仙人掌圖】仙人掌DP學習筆記,cactusdp

【Cactus仙人掌圖】仙人掌DP學習筆記,cactusdp 我們從例題入手來考慮仙人掌上DP的一般規律叭.Ex 1.仙人掌上的單源最短路問題 聯想樹上最短路,由於路徑的唯一性可以直接做一遍O(n)的搜尋.但是仙人掌上顯然不具備路徑的唯一性這種性質. 那麼我們是否需要像對待一般的無向連通圖一樣使用最短路演算法呢? 其實並不需要. 首先一遍DFS處理出仙人掌的結構關係.

js中移除空白節點,js移除空白節點

js中移除空白節點,js移除空白節點//移除空白節點,空白節點的類型是3function removeWhiteNode(node) {    for (var i = 0; i < node.childNodes.length; i++) {        if (node.childNodes[i].nodeType === 3 &&

嵌入式linux------ffmpeg移植 編碼H264(am335x編碼H264),ffmpegh264

嵌入式linux------ffmpeg移植 編碼H264(am335x編碼H264),ffmpegh264/*arm-linux-gcc -o yuv2264 yuv2264.c -I/usr/local/ffmpeg_arm/include/ -L/usr/local/ffmpeg_arm/lib/ -lswresample -lavformat -lavutil -lavcodec -lswscale -lx264 libSDL.a*/#include

uva 11374 Airport Express(最短路),11374airport

uva 11374 Airport Express(最短路),11374airport uva 11374 Airport ExpressIn a small city called Iokh, a train service, Airport-Express, takes residents to the airport more quickly than other transports. There are two types of trains in

【LeetCode-面試演算法經典-Java實現】【029-Divide Two Integers(兩個整數相除)】,leetcode--java

【LeetCode-面試演算法經典-Java實現】【029-Divide Two Integers(兩個整數相除)】,leetcode--java 【029-Divide Two Integers(兩個整數相除)】【LeetCode-面試演算法經典-Java實現】【所有題目目錄索引】原題  Divide two integers without using multiplication, division and mod operator.   If it is overflow,

總頁數: 6053 1 .... 157 158 159 160 161 .... 6053 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.